International channels operator SPI/FilmBox and Moçambique Telecom (Tmcel) have partnered to make SPI’s Dizi channel accessible to mobile subscribers in Mozambique.

The Dizi channel already reaches millions of households worldwide across CEE, western Europe, the Adria region and Africa through multiple operators with its slate of Turkish drama series.

Through this new partnership, subscribers will be able to access Dizi through one of Africa’s leading live mobile TV streaming platforms, Yabadoo.

Georgina Twiss, MD for western Europe and Africa at SPI International, said: “Our partnership with Tmcel for Dizi will surely excite the growing number of on-the-go fans of Turkish series in Mozambique who enjoy watching their favourite TV shows on their mobile devices.

“With Yabadoo, Tmcel subscribers can immerse themselves in the beautiful scenery and gripping storylines of the Dizi series without sacrificing their internet data and at their convenience.”

Adil Ginaby, Tmcel’s marketing manager, added: “With this partnership, Tmcel clients, specially Dizi lovers, will have access full-time to a variety of TV content, live and on-demand. Not charging mobile data is a differentiator with this service that, through Tmcel, will bring emotion to every customer.”
